Ms. Katie Marie Utley Wells, age 80, of Wynne, Arkansas, passed away Thursday, February 19, 2015, at Crestpark Nursing Home in Wynne, Arkansas.

Ms. Wells was born in Parkin, Arkansas on September 16, 1934, to William Ruben Utley and Minnie Eudora Pitts Utley who preceded her in death.

She is also preceded in death by her daughter, Carol Kay Wells; sisters, Mary Ruth and Mildred Louise Utley; and brothers, Floyd and James Utley. Katie was a member of Levesque Assembly of God at Levesque.

She is survived by her sons, Jeff Wells of Michigan; Jerry Wells of Huntsville, Alabama; Tony Wells of Earle; Toby Wells of Jonesboro, Arkansas; brothers, J. T. Utley, Lester Utley, Robert Allen Utley all of Wynne; Ruben Leon Utley of North Little Rock; John Dee Utley of Colorado; and Danny Utley of Jonesboro; sister, Linda Sue Turpin of Clarksville, Arkansas; nine grand-children, six great grand-children and two great-great grand-children on the way.

Services were held at Levesque Assembly of God with burail in Harris Chapel Cemetery.
